Neuroscience is challenging, like most science majors. It takes focus, steady effort, and strong study habits.
During your studies, you’ll take courses in biology and chemistry while learning how the brain works and how to read and analyze scientific research.
Many classes include labs, giving you the chance to test what you learn through experiments and data collection. At first, the material might feel overwhelming, but over time, the ideas start to connect, and confidence grows.
What Makes It Challenging?
Neuroscience combines multiple areas of science. You’ll learn how:
- Brain cells communicate
- Different systems in the body work together
- To read and evaluate scientific studies
- To analyze data carefully
Courses include technical vocabulary and complex processes. Success requires organization, time management, and consistent practice.

Is It the Right Fit for You?
Neuroscience may be a good fit if you:
- Enjoy science and learning how systems work
- Are willing to work steadily, even when material feels challenging
- Like solving problems and thinking carefully
It’s a demanding major, but with focus and support, it’s a doable and rewarding experience that opens doors to many career paths.
